using Aryx.AgentHost.Contracts;
using GitHub.Copilot.SDK;
using GitHub.Copilot.SDK.Rpc;
namespace Aryx.AgentHost.Services;
internal sealed class CopilotSessionManager : ICopilotSessionManager
{
public async Task<IReadOnlyDictionary<string, QuotaSnapshotDto>> GetQuotaAsync(
CancellationToken cancellationToken)
{
await using CopilotClient client = await CreateStartedClientAsync(cancellationToken).ConfigureAwait(false);
AccountGetQuotaResult result = await client.Rpc.Account.GetQuotaAsync(cancellationToken).ConfigureAwait(false);
return QuotaSnapshotMapper.Map(result.QuotaSnapshots);
}
public async Task<IReadOnlyList<CopilotSessionInfoDto>> ListSessionsAsync(
CopilotSessionListFilterDto? filter,
CancellationToken cancellationToken)
{
await using CopilotClient client = await CreateStartedClientAsync(cancellationToken).ConfigureAwait(false);
List<SessionMetadata> sessions = await client.ListSessionsAsync(CreateFilter(filter), cancellationToken)
.ConfigureAwait(false);
return sessions
.Select(MapSession)
.OrderByDescending(session => session.ModifiedTime, StringComparer.Ordinal)
.ToList();
}
public async Task<IReadOnlyList<CopilotSessionInfoDto>> DeleteSessionsAsync(
string? aryxSessionId,
string? copilotSessionId,
CancellationToken cancellationToken)
{
string? normalizedAryxSessionId = Normalize(aryxSessionId);
string? normalizedCopilotSessionId = Normalize(copilotSessionId);
if (normalizedAryxSessionId is null && normalizedCopilotSessionId is null)
{
throw new InvalidOperationException("delete-session requires a sessionId or copilotSessionId.");
}
await using CopilotClient client = await CreateStartedClientAsync(cancellationToken).ConfigureAwait(false);
List<SessionMetadata> sessions = await client.ListSessionsAsync(null, cancellationToken).ConfigureAwait(false);
List<CopilotSessionInfoDto> targets = sessions
.Select(MapSession)
.Where(session =>
(normalizedCopilotSessionId is not null
&& string.Equals(session.CopilotSessionId, normalizedCopilotSessionId, StringComparison.Ordinal))
|| (normalizedAryxSessionId is not null
&& string.Equals(session.SessionId, normalizedAryxSessionId, StringComparison.Ordinal)
&& session.ManagedByAryx))
.ToList();
if (targets.Count == 0 && normalizedCopilotSessionId is not null)
{
targets.Add(CreateUnknownSessionInfo(normalizedCopilotSessionId));
}
foreach (CopilotSessionInfoDto target in targets)
{
await client.DeleteSessionAsync(target.CopilotSessionId, cancellationToken).ConfigureAwait(false);
}
return targets;
}
private static async Task<CopilotClient> CreateStartedClientAsync(CancellationToken cancellationToken)
{
CopilotClient client = new(CopilotCliPathResolver.CreateClientOptions());
await client.StartAsync(cancellationToken).ConfigureAwait(false);
return client;
}
private static SessionListFilter? CreateFilter(CopilotSessionListFilterDto? filter)
{
if (filter is null)
{
return null;
}
return new SessionListFilter
{
Cwd = Normalize(filter.Cwd),
GitRoot = Normalize(filter.GitRoot),
Repository = Normalize(filter.Repository),
Branch = Normalize(filter.Branch),
};
}
private static CopilotSessionInfoDto MapSession(SessionMetadata session)
{
bool managedByAryx = CopilotManagedSessionIds.TryParse(
session.SessionId,
out string aryxSessionId,
out string agentId);
return new CopilotSessionInfoDto
{
CopilotSessionId = session.SessionId,
ManagedByAryx = managedByAryx,
SessionId = managedByAryx ? aryxSessionId : null,
AgentId = managedByAryx ? agentId : null,
StartTime = session.StartTime.ToUniversalTime().ToString("O"),
ModifiedTime = session.ModifiedTime.ToUniversalTime().ToString("O"),
Summary = Normalize(session.Summary),
IsRemote = session.IsRemote,
Cwd = Normalize(session.Context?.Cwd),
GitRoot = Normalize(session.Context?.GitRoot),
Repository = Normalize(session.Context?.Repository),
Branch = Normalize(session.Context?.Branch),
};
}
private static CopilotSessionInfoDto CreateUnknownSessionInfo(string copilotSessionId)
{
bool managedByAryx = CopilotManagedSessionIds.TryParse(
copilotSessionId,
out string aryxSessionId,
out string agentId);
return new CopilotSessionInfoDto
{
CopilotSessionId = copilotSessionId,
ManagedByAryx = managedByAryx,
SessionId = managedByAryx ? aryxSessionId : null,
AgentId = managedByAryx ? agentId : null,
};
}
private static string? Normalize(string? value)
=> string.IsNullOrWhiteSpace(value) ? null : value.Trim();
}
